次の方法で共有


PrjCompleteCommand 関数 (projectedfslib.h)

プロバイダーが以前に HRESULT_FROM_WIN32(ERROR_IO_PENDING) を返したコールバックの処理を完了したことを示します。

構文

HRESULT PrjCompleteCommand(
  [in]           PRJ_NAMESPACE_VIRTUALIZATION_CONTEXT     namespaceVirtualizationContext,
  [in]           INT32                                    commandId,
  [in]           HRESULT                                  completionResult,
  [in, optional] PRJ_COMPLETE_COMMAND_EXTENDED_PARAMETERS *extendedParameters
);

パラメーター

[in] namespaceVirtualizationContext

仮想化インスタンスの不透明なハンドル。 これは、完了中のコールバックでプロバイダーに渡される callbackData の VirtualizationInstanceHandle メンバーの値である必要があります。

[in] commandId

プロバイダーが完了しているコールバック呼び出しを識別する値。 これは、完了中のコールバックでプロバイダーに渡される callbackData の CommandId メンバーの値である必要があります。

[in] completionResult

操作の最後の HRESULT。

[in, optional] extendedParameters

特定のコールバックを完了するために必要な拡張パラメーターへの省略可能なポインター。

戻り値

この関数が成功すると、S_OKが返 されます。 それ以外の場合は、 HRESULT エラー コードが返されます。

Requirements

Requirement 価値
サポートされる最小クライアント Windows 10 バージョン 1809 [デスクトップ アプリのみ]
サポートされている最小のサーバー Windows Server [デスクトップ アプリのみ]
ターゲット プラットフォーム ウィンドウズ
Header projectedfslib.h
Library ProjectedFSLib.lib